The BSc (Hons) Accounting and Finance with Foundation Year - 36 months program is a three-year undergraduate degree that offers students a solid foundation in accounting principles, financial management, and business ethics. The course is structured to provide students with a blend of theoretical knowledge and practical skills that are essential for success in the accounting and finance industry.
Year | Modules |
---|---|
Foundation Year | Introduction to Accounting, Business Mathematics, Financial Management |
Year 1 | Financial Accounting, Management Accounting, Business Economics |
Year 2 | Corporate Finance, Taxation, Auditing |
Year 3 | Advanced Financial Reporting, Strategic Management, Financial Analysis |
